This turkey bagel sandwich recipe is perfect if you're looking for Thanksgiving leftover ideas - or anytime! Smoked cheese, hot-sweet mustard, and chewy pumpernickel make for a different take on a turkey sandwich.

Turkey Bagel Sandwich 1 pumpernickel bagel sliced in half and toasted 6 oz sliced turkey 3 slices smoked gouda cheese Sweet Hot Mustard 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ard very zesty variety ½ teaspoon honey
Slice bagel in half and toast
Pile turkey high on a plate and top with cheese. Microwave until turkey is hot and cheese melts.
Combine mustard and honey in a small bowl.
Spread mustard mixture onto bagel, top with warm turkey and cheese and enjoy!
